Supertrapp makes great self-tunable exhausts. Tenzo mufflers are great for adding some HP to the higher RPM range. Stillen headers are great and lighter than most headers out there. Lightspeed is great. Make sure your headers are coated.

Yeah, those exhausts were WAY hella loud! I believe the EVO is quieter than the N1, but it depends on what car each of them is installed on, and what other toys each car has done as well. An EVO hooked to a header might be louder than an N1 hooked to stock exhaust manifold, even though N1 is louder as an exhaust itself.
